A film by Erika Speed Location: Edwards Island Cinemas(inside the Fashion Island mall), 999 Newport Center Drive, Newport Beach, 92660 Time: 11 am Run time: 75 min. | USA Remember the Rubik’s Cube? What started as a worldwide fad has now become a competitive sport called “speedcubing,” with competitors unscrambling cubes in as little as twelve mind-bending seconds. “CubeFreak” tells the story of three people fascinated by the Rubik’s Cube: Tyson, a brilliant mind from Caltech, who has resurrected the cube competitions around the country, Macky, the 2006 Guinness Book World Record holder, and Sunil, a quirky yet exceptional high-school student and cube connoisseur. The film follows these cubers on the quest to bring the cube back to the forefront of popular culture. Read our prior Spotlight "Conversation with Tyson Mao" by clicking here.
